Recognize Signs of Risky Behavior

One of the most important steps in responsible gaming is recognizing early warning signs. The sooner someone notices concerning behavior patterns, the easier it is to take positive action.

Financial Problems

Borrowing money to gamble, using essential funds like rent or bills for gaming, or constantly feeling short of money after playing.

Loss of Time Control

Playing longer than intended, neglecting work, family, or other responsibilities for gaming, or feeling unable to stop despite wanting to.

Negative Emotional Impact

Feeling anxious, depressed or angry when unable to play; using gaming to escape problems or emotional stress.

Chasing Losses

Continuing to play or increasing bets in an attempt to recover lost money is one of the most dangerous signs and must stop immediately.

Hiding Habits

Lying to family or friends about how much you play or the amount of money spent on online gaming.

Increasing Bets

Needing to bet larger amounts to achieve the same excitement, or feeling bored with smaller bets that were once enough.

Advice on Setting Healthy Time & Budget Limits

Responsible gaming starts with good planning. Here are some practical guidelines recommended by 15th for all users in Malaysia:

  • Set a fixed gaming budget per month — the amount you can afford to lose without affecting basic living expenses such as food, bills, and rent.
  • Set playtime limits before starting your session, and stick to those limits even if you’re winning or close to winning.
  • Never gamble with borrowed money, emergency savings, or money allocated for other responsibilities.
  • Take regular breaks — take a break from the screen every 30 to 45 minutes, drink water, and do other activities before continuing.
  • Avoid playing when emotionally unstable — work stress, family arguments, or depression can impair judgment and increase the risk of losses.
  • Track your spending — keep simple records of your monthly deposits and withdrawals to gain a clear overview of your gaming behavior.
  • Play for enjoyment, not as a source of income. Online gaming is entertainment, not an investment or a job.

Important Reminder

In-game odds always favor the platform over the long term. Short-term wins are possible, but consistent long-term wins are highly unlikely. Always play with this awareness.
